Where is Whitney Houston father from?
Houston was born in Trenton, N.J., in 1920, and was living in Fort Lee, N.J., at the time of his death. His theatrical management agency was based in Newark, N.J., the city where his daughter was born.
What did John Russell Houston do for a living?
Father of singer Whitney Houston, John Russell Houston Jr. was a theatrical manager since the early days of rhythm and blues. Well before his daughter’s rise to fame, Houston managed the career of her mother and his ex-wife, Cissy Houston.
